Pioneering Culinary Fermentation

Planit POD is more than a project — it is a venture conceived, funded, and built by DuPuis Group, giving us the opportunity to apply the same strategic and creative disciplines we bring to our clients to a business of our own.

The idea was passionately pursued by our founder, Steven DuPuis, and his late wife, Joy, both advocates for plant-forward living. It started with a simple question: What if fermentation could help create a new generation of plant-based foods?

From the early concept and consumer research through invention, strategy, industrial design, branding, engineering, commercialization, and launch, Planit POD has brought together nearly every capability within DuPuis. In partnership with Waring, we introduced the product to the foodservice industry at the 2026 NRA Show, where it received the Kitchen Innovations Best of Show award — a meaningful recognition for a vision that has been more than a decade in the making.


Challenge

For years, the plant based protein category had largely focused on imitating meat. But consumers and chefs were looking for something different—better flavor, more creativity, and a plant based experience that could stand on its own. The opportunity was to move beyond the idea of meat alternatives and rethink what plant protein could be from the ground up, using the transformative potential of fermentation to create an entirely new experience of plant based consumption and enjoyment.

Action Taken

DuPuis led the innovation journey from initial insight through commercialization, exploring how fermentation could open up new possibilities for plant based flavor. Guided by consumer research and culinary exploration, we developed the Planit Protein platform and positioned the Planit POD as a new kind of kitchen appliance—one that gives chefs and food innovators the tools to create new flavors using koji culture and purpose built Ground Protein.

DuPuis led every aspect of the venture, including innovation strategy, positioning, naming, branding, industrial design direction, packaging, photography, messaging, digital experience, and commercialization. Every decision was anchored in one clear belief: plant protein shouldn't try to imitate meat—it should stand on its own.

Results

The work transformed Planit Protein into a category defining platform rooted in fermentation, culinary creativity, and authentic flavor. The strategy resonated with chefs, food innovators, and industry partners, culminating in the launch of Planit POD with Waring at the National Restaurant Association Show, where it received the prestigious Kitchen Innovations Best of Show Award.
